Solid Waste Pickup

The City of Portage la Prairie operates a 5-day solid waste collection cycle. Schedules may be viewed on our Waste Collection Page, obtained at City Hall, or by telephoning the Operations Department at 204-239-8346. Garbage collection is on the front street year round. It is advised that you put your garbage out prior to 7:00 a.m. on your collection day. There is a two bag/can limit on the amount of solid waste that will be picked up from the curb each collection day. Anything over that amount must have a Solid Waste Collection Tag affixed. These tags can be purchased from all corner stores (except 7-11), all grocery stores, MCC, City Hall and the Operations Department.

Portage & District Recycling is a fully operational household hazardous waste depot.  The items listed below will be accepted at Portage & District Recycling (700 Phillips St.), 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. We ask that residents DO NOT put these items on curbside for pick-up.

  • Paint cans and Aerosol Paint
  • Fluorescent Light Bulbs
  • Pesticides
  • Aerosol Cans (Hair Spray/Lysol cans/Febreze)
  • Corrosive Liquids (Bleach/Drano)
  • Oxidizing Liquids
  • Compressed Gas (Propane Tanks)
  • Adhesives
  • Fire Extinguishers
  • Toxic Liquids (Lidocane Chloride)
  • Tires
  • E-waste
  • Oil
  • Batteries

Tree Disposal Site (Burn Site)

The Tree Disposal Site is located behind the Water Pollution Control Facility, east of River Road (PR 240), where only trees and tree trimmings may be disposed of. The site is open 9:00 am – 9:00 pm, 7 days per week. The tree disposal site is for use by City of Portage la Prairie residents only and not for commercial use. Only tree trimmings less than 2 meters long will be accepted. Disposal of anything other than trees (garbage, engineered wood, pressboard, metal, septic tank effluent, waste oil, etc) is strictly prohibited. Compost Site

The City of Portage la Prairie operates a compost site at the corner of 4th Avenue N.W. and 15th Street N.W. The site accepts all organic yard and garden waste (no tree trimmings, no animal waste). The site is open 24 hours per day, 7 days a week. To keep the compost site free of garbage please remove your compostable waste from plastic bags and place unwanted bags in the garbage container. Finished compost is available for use annually.
